With the 2015 regular legislative session history, James Yates said he will be stepping down as counsel to the state Assembly’s speaker and the chamber’s Democratic majority.

Yates, 68, attended the final news conference of the session last week at the Capitol hours before the Assembly and Senate concluded passing the final bills of a tumultuous session which saw both former Assembly Speaker Sheldon Silver, D-Manhattan, and Senate Majority Leader Dean Skelos, R-Rockville Centre, resign their leadershp posts after being indicted on corruption charges by the Southern District U.S. Attorney’s office.
